高分辨率磁敏感加权像对颅内肿瘤微血管的研究

     

摘要

Purpose: To investigate the features of the micrangium of the intracranial tumors on high-resolution susceptibility-weighted imaging (SWI) , and to estimate the diagnostic and differential diagnostic value of SWI. Methods: Fourty-eight cases of postoperative pathological and clinical follow-up confirmed intracrarnial tumors were enrolled in our study. The features of the tumors were graded based upon intratumral susceptibility signals (ITSS), and % test was used to analyze the data. Results were represented by x+s and significant threshold was set as P<0.05. Results: The grade of ITSS of the high grade gliomas was obviously higher than that of the low grade gliomas (P<0.01. The grade of ITSS of the high grade gliomas was obviously higher than that of the lymphadenomas (P<0.01) . SWI was much better than the routine sequences of MRI in displaying the micrangium of the intracrarnial tumors. Conclusion: SWI can better display inner structure of the intracrarnial tumors, micrangium of the intracrarnial tumors, and can provide additional valuable information in clinical diagnosis and treatment.%目的:探讨高分辨率磁敏感加权像(SWI)对颅内肿瘤微血管表现,评价SWI在肿瘤定性诊断和鉴别诊断中的价值.方法:48例经手术病理证实或临床随访证实颅内肿瘤.根据SWI肿瘤内磁敏感信号(ITSS)进行分级,对所得数据资料行x2检验,结果以x-±s表示,以P<0.05判定为有显著性差异.结果:高级别星形细胞瘤ITSS级别高于低级别星形细胞瘤(P<0.01),高级别星形细胞瘤ITSS级别高于淋巴瘤(P<0.01).在显示颅内肿瘤微血管方面SWI明显优于MRI常规序列.结论:SWI有助于对颅内肿瘤内部结构显示,特别瘤内微血管,为临床诊治提供有价值的补充信息.
